About Broadbeach Waters 4218

The size of Broadbeach Waters is approximately 5.3 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 5.9% of total area. The population of Broadbeach Waters in 2011 was 7,534 people. By 2016 the population was 7,783 showing a population growth of 3.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Broadbeach Waters is 40-49 years. Households in Broadbeach Waters are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Broadbeach Waters work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 73.5% of the homes in Broadbeach Waters were owner-occupied compared with 72.3% in 2016.

Broadbeach Waters has 4,025 properties.
